Emerging technologies in prostate cancer treatment
Emerging technologies in prostate cancer treatment are reshaping how cancer is found, mapped, and treated. Advanced MRI and PET scans help doctors see tumors more clearly, identify aggressive areas, and guide biopsies to the most suspicious spots rather than sampling tissue at random. This reduces the risk of missing higher risk disease and can prevent unnecessary repeat procedures.
In 2025, image guided tools are increasingly paired with sophisticated software. Fusion biopsy systems combine MRI images with real time ultrasound, while artificial intelligence algorithms assist radiologists in interpreting subtle findings. These technologies do not replace specialists but support them in making more accurate assessments about whether cancer is low, intermediate, or high risk, which directly influences treatment planning.
Minimally invasive and precision based therapies
Minimally invasive and precision based therapies have become central to modern prostate cancer care. Robotic assisted surgery allows urologic surgeons to operate through small incisions with fine control, often resulting in shorter hospital stays and a faster physical recovery compared with traditional open surgery. Surgeons can work with magnified 3D views, which may help with nerve sparing techniques that aim to preserve erectile and urinary function.
For some men, precise energy based treatments offer another option. Techniques such as high intensity focused ultrasound and focal laser ablation are being used in carefully selected patients to treat only the cancerous portion of the prostate while leaving the rest of the gland intact. These focal therapies are still evolving and are not suitable for everyone, but they reflect a broader shift toward tailoring treatment to the size, location, and behavior of each tumor.
Radiation therapy has also become more precise. Modern external beam radiation uses advanced planning and daily imaging to target the prostate and areas at risk while limiting exposure to nearby organs like the bladder and rectum. Some centers offer hypofractionated schedules, delivering radiation in fewer sessions, which may be more convenient for working adults and caregivers.
When systemic treatments are the right choice
When systemic treatments are the right choice, the goal shifts from treating only the prostate to managing cancer cells that may have spread elsewhere in the body. In men with advanced or metastatic disease, hormone therapy remains a cornerstone by lowering or blocking testosterone, which prostate cancer cells often rely on to grow. Newer hormone based medications can be more potent and are sometimes used earlier in the course of illness.
Other systemic treatments include chemotherapy, targeted therapies, and newer immunotherapy approaches. Targeted medicines may home in on specific genetic changes within cancer cells, such as DNA repair defects. In some cases, men are offered genetic testing of their tumors or blood to see whether these drugs are likely to help. Immunotherapies aim to help the immune system recognize and attack cancer, and while they are not yet suitable for all patients, they are an active area of research.
Choosing systemic therapy involves weighing potential benefits, such as longer survival or slower disease progression, against side effects like fatigue, hot flashes, or changes in bone health. Doctors often combine treatments or sequence them over time, adjusting plans based on how well the cancer responds and how a person feels day to day.
Active surveillance: a smarter way to manage early cancer
Active surveillance is increasingly seen as a smarter way to manage early prostate cancer that appears low risk and slow growing. Instead of immediate treatment, men are closely monitored with regular prostate specific antigen blood tests, digital rectal exams, imaging, and sometimes repeat biopsies. The intention is to avoid or delay side effects from surgery or radiation while still acting promptly if signs of progression appear.
In the United States, many guidelines now encourage doctors to discuss active surveillance with appropriate patients, particularly those with small volume, low grade disease. This approach relies on good communication and a shared understanding of the monitoring plan. While it can be emotionally challenging to live with untreated cancer, clear information about risk level and regular follow up can help many men feel comfortable with this choice.
Over time, some individuals on active surveillance may switch to curative treatment if their cancer changes. Others may stay on surveillance for years without needing further intervention. The flexibility of this strategy supports more personalized care rather than a one size fits all response to diagnosis.
Prostate cancer awareness and early action in 2025
Prostate cancer awareness and early action in 2025 focus on informed screening and risk understanding rather than blanket testing. The prostate specific antigen blood test is no longer viewed as a simple yes or no trigger for treatment. Instead, results are interpreted in the context of age, family history, race, overall health, and changes over time.
Men with higher risk profiles, such as those with a close relative who had prostate cancer or some men of African ancestry, may discuss starting conversations about screening earlier with their clinicians. For others, the focus may be on understanding the benefits and limits of screening, including the possibility of finding cancers that might never cause harm. Shared decision making is central, helping each person align choices with their values and tolerance for uncertainty.
Public health efforts increasingly stress lifestyle factors as well. Maintaining a healthy weight, regular physical activity, not smoking, and managing conditions like high blood pressure and diabetes are all important for overall health and may influence cancer outcomes. Awareness campaigns in communities and online aim to reduce stigma, encourage open conversations, and ensure more men seek evaluation for urinary changes or other concerning symptoms.
